In the world of electrical safety, standards aren’t just recommendations: they’re vital protocols that safeguard lives, property, and productivity. One of the most important but often overlooked of these standards is NFPA 70B: Recommended Practice for Electrical Equipment Maintenance.
This guide, published by the National Fire Protection Association (NFPA), serves as a critical resource for anyone responsible for maintaining electrical systems, from facility managers and electricians to safety officers and industrial engineers.
It provides detailed recommendations on maintaining electrical systems in safe and operational conditions. Unlike NFPA 70, which focuses on installation requirements, 70B zeroes in on maintenance practices, ensuring that once systems are installed, they continue to operate safely and efficiently.
NFPA 70B
This standard was developed to address the increasing number of electrical failures in industrial and commercial settings caused by improper maintenance or neglect. Many organizations invest heavily in electrical infrastructure but fail to implement long-term maintenance strategies. This oversight leads to preventable outages, increased safety risks, and costly repairs.
To combat this, NFPA 70B was first introduced in 1973. It was designed to bridge the gap between installation (covered by NFPA 70) and operational safety (addressed in NFPA 70E, which focuses on electrical safety in the workplace). This code is focused on how to properly maintain electrical systems through regular inspections, testing, cleaning, lubrication, and documentation.

NFPA 70B and Its New Requirements
One of the most significant developments in recent years is that NFPA 70B is transitioning from a recommended practice to a standard. As of the 2023 edition, NFPA 70B is no longer just a suggestion, it is now being treated as a mandatory standard by many organizations and jurisdictions.
Key Updates in the 2023 Edition:
- Mandatory Maintenance Schedules: Facilities must now adhere to defined maintenance intervals based on equipment type, usage, and environment.
- Risk-Based Maintenance Approach: The standard now encourages assessments of the risk level of equipment failure, helping prioritize maintenance tasks.
- Condition-Based Monitoring (CBM): Instead of relying solely on calendar-based maintenance, NFPA 70B now emphasizes the use of tools like infrared thermography, ultrasound testing, and motor circuit analysis to assess real-time equipment condition.
- Comprehensive Documentation: A major new requirement includes extensive record keeping to track inspections, test results, repairs, and equipment history.
These updates make NFPA 70B new requirements more aligned with modern safety management systems, making them crucial for facility managers and safety professionals to understand and implement.

70B standard
Maintenance Intervals
The standard provides interval schedules for inspection and testing, based on equipment type and environment (e.g., high dust, high humidity).
Thermal Imaging
This code outlines the use of infrared thermography to identify hotspots, loose connections, and overloaded circuits — a key feature of condition-based monitoring.
Electrical Testing Procedures
It includes methods for insulation resistance testing, continuity tests, ground resistance tests, and more.
Battery and UPS System Maintenance
Guidelines ensure these critical systems are ready during power failures, including cleaning terminals, checking fluid levels, and load testing.
Record keeping and Documentation
Facilities must retain detailed logs of all maintenance activities, test results, and corrective actions for compliance and diagnostics.
Common Misconceptions
“It’s only for big facilities.”
Even small commercial facilities benefit from structured maintenance to reduce downtime and improve safety.
“It’s just a recommendation.”
As of the 2023 edition, NFPA 70B is no longer just a best practice — it’s being enforced by many jurisdictions.
“We maintain equipment when it breaks.”
That’s corrective maintenance. NFPA 70B promotes preventive and predictive maintenance to avoid breakdowns.
